Mercedes-Benz: Mercedes-Benz and smart install electric recharging points across their dealer networks
(06/07/2010)

Mercedes-Benz and smart are preparing for the widespread uptake of electric vehicles (EVs) in the UK by beginning the installation of recharging points across their dealer networks. Mercedes: Prototype electric version of the Mercedes Vito Taxi ready for trials
(30/03/2010)

A prototype electric version of the Mercedes Vito Taxi has been designed and built by a consortium of British technology companies. Part-funded by the UK Government’s Advantage Niche Vehicle Research & Development Programme, the prototype vehicle meets the demanding requirements of the London Carriage Office and can carry up to six people more than 120 kilometres on a single six hour charge.
